Pan 7 年 前
コミット
12012e3b24
共有3 個のファイルを変更した9 個の追加7 個の削除を含む
  1. 0 5
      src/App.vue
  2. 8 1
      src/main.js
  3. 1 1
      src/styles/element-ui.scss

+ 0 - 5
src/App.vue

@@ -9,8 +9,3 @@ export default {
9 9
   name: 'app'
10 10
 }
11 11
 </script>
12
-
13
-<style lang="scss">
14
-  // @import '~normalize.css/normalize.css';// normalize.css 样式格式化
15
-  @import './styles/index.scss'; // 全局自定义的css样式
16
-</style>

+ 8 - 1
src/main.js

@@ -1,12 +1,19 @@
1 1
 import Vue from 'vue'
2
+
3
+import 'normalize.css/normalize.css'// A modern alternative to CSS resets
4
+
2 5
 import ElementUI from 'element-ui'
3 6
 import 'element-ui/lib/theme-chalk/index.css'
4 7
 import locale from 'element-ui/lib/locale/lang/en'
8
+
9
+import '@/styles/index.scss' // global css
10
+
5 11
 import App from './App'
6 12
 import router from './router'
7 13
 import store from './store'
14
+
8 15
 import '@/icons' // icon
9
-import '@/permission' // 权限
16
+import '@/permission' // permission control
10 17
 
11 18
 Vue.use(ElementUI, { locale })
12 19
 

+ 1 - 1
src/styles/element-ui.scss

@@ -1,4 +1,4 @@
1
- //覆盖一些element-ui样式 覆盖css样式可在这里添加
1
+ //to reset element-ui default css
2 2
 .el-upload {
3 3
   input[type="file"] {
4 4
     display: none !important;